Main Street Credit
Starting January 1, 2006, businesses were able to apply electronically for a credit against the B&O tax and public utility tax equal to:

  • 75% of approved contributions to designated revitalization programs, or
  • 50% of approved contributions to the Main Street Trust Fund.

The tax credit request must be approved prior to making a contribution to a designated organization such as the HDCA (Historic Downtown Chelan Association). Businesses applying for the credit must be signed up to file electronically (E-file) with the Department of Revenue. Once a business is registered to file electronically, it can log on to its E-file account and click on the Main Street Credit link. The business only needs to know the organization it intends to contribute to (e.g., HDCA) and how much it intends to contribute to apply for the program. The application is simply a matter of inputting this information. The credit may only be claimed in the calendar year immediately following the calendar year in which the credit was approved by the department and the contribution was made to the program (e.g., HDCA). Credits may not be carried over to subsequent years. No refunds may be granted for credits.

Donations to Historic Downtown Chelan Association are NOT limited just to businesses in the city of Chelan.  Our legislature knows that a strong downtown core helps all of the companies in a region. 

  • $1.5 million in credits— total available statewide
  • $100,000 in credits maximum per community
  • The Historic Downtown Chelan Association can actually receive annually up to $133,333 in donations through this program
  • Receiving organization must be 501-C3 or 501-C6 —focused on downtown revitalization (Historic Downtown Chelan Association qualifies)
  • Must be pre-approved by WA Dept. of Revenue. 
  • 75% of the donation is your B&O tax credit to be used in the following year
  • 100% of your donation can be claimed on your federal return as a charitable contribution in the year of the donation **
  • Companies must file in electronic format
